The Necessary Responsibilities of a Registered Representative
Agent for corporations
A registered agent plays an important duty in the legal and management structure of a company. Their key duty is to function as the main factor of call in between a firm and the state government. This indicates that they need to be readily available throughout regular service hours to obtain lawful documents, government notices, and service of process in behalf of business. Guaranteeing timely invoice of such records is essential for preserving conformity and staying clear of legal difficulties. Registered representatives likewise manage vital communication pertaining to state filings, yearly reports, and various other legal demands. They must keep accurate documents of all communications got and make certain that the company reacts suitably within marked time frameworks. As a result of the delicate nature of their tasks, registered representatives should be reputable, accessible, and experienced about lawful treatments and target dates. Several companies choose professional registered agent services to make certain these duties are handled appropriately and regularly, specifically if business proprietor can not always be available during office hours. In general, the registered agent works as a relied on intermediary that aids safeguard the company's legal standing and helps with smooth interaction with government agencies.
